THE BHARAT SCOUTS AND GUIDES

Service, Discipline, Leadership

The Bharat Scouts & Guides is a voluntary, non-political, and educational movement for young people in India. Open to all without distinction of origin, race, or creed, it is founded on the timeless principles introduced by Lord Baden Powell in 1907. The movement focuses on building character, leadership, discipline, and a strong sense of community through experiential learning.

Purpose & Values

The Scout/Guide Movement is guided by three core principles:

  • Duty to God: Upholding spiritual values and responsibilities.
  • Duty to Others: Promoting peace, cooperation, and respect for society and nature.
  • Duty to Self: Encouraging personal growth and self-development.

Learning Approach

The Scout/Guide Method emphasizes:

  • Learning by doing
  • Teamwork through the Patrol System
  • Progressive, activity-based programmes
  • Commitment to the Promise and Law

Promise & Law

Scouts and Guides pledge to serve their country, help others, and live by values such as trustworthiness, loyalty, courage, discipline, and respect for nature—shaping responsible global citizens.

Scouting at South City International School

At South City International School, the programme is thoughtfully structured into four wings to nurture students at every stage:

Boys Wings

  • Cubs (Grades 1–5)
  • Scouts (Grades 6–10)

Girls Wings

  • Bulbuls (Grades 1–5)
  • Guides (Grades 6–10)

Through these divisions, the school fosters leadership, teamwork, and life skills in a progressive and engaging environment, empowering students to grow into confident and responsible individuals.
